Berliner Potato Salad (Berliner Kartoffelsalat)

ingredients
2 pounds potatoes, whole
6 baby dill pickles, chopped
1 medium onion, chopped
1 medium Granny Smith apple, chopped
16 ounces mayonnaise
6 tablespoons pickle juice
1 tablespoon sugar
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
directions
Make sure onion, pickles and apple are chopped the same size.
Boil the potatoes with their skins on until tender, about 20-30 minutes.
Remove from pot and let rest until cool enough to handle but still warm, then peel and dice into preferred size.
In a bowl, combine all the ingredients except potatoes.
Put potatoes into a big bowl, pour "sauce" over them and stir together carefully (potatoes break apart easily while still warm). Cover bowl and let rest in refrigerator for at least 2 hours (overnight is even better).
Taste test and add more pickle juice, salt, pepper, sugar or mayonnaise if/as needed.
